Nobutoshi Canna was born on 10 June 1968 in Tokyo, Japan. He is an actor, known for Berserk (1997), Guilty Crown (2011) and Transformers: Energon (2004).

    • Quotes
      On a very basic level, both live-action tokusatsu and anime are very similar. The technical differences that we have are things like, for example, the recording in anime being separated into A role and B role, so we go through the roles in order, but in tokusatsu, it's split up into many smaller sections. However, when I'm in a Super Sentai series, I often play bad guys, so there's this kind of certain feeling that you get when you're playing a bad guy that you don't really get to have in other roles. Because of that, I really enjoy playing the bad guys in Sentai series!
